Biography of Jeffrey Truitt MD

Jeffrey T. Truitt MD is a physician with a strong focus on two important medical fields: pain medicine and anesthesiology. He's been helping patients for quite some time, actually, with over 19 years of experience in the medical field. This long period of practice suggests a deep understanding of his areas of focus, which is, you know, a very good thing when you're seeking medical help.

His educational path began at Drexel University College of Medicine, where he received his medical degree. After that, he completed a residency at Thomas Jefferson University Hospitals. This kind of training is, like, pretty rigorous and prepares doctors for the challenges of patient care. It's where they really hone their abilities and gain practical wisdom.

Currently, Jeffrey Truitt MD is an affiliate clinician with Jefferson Health, which is a big healthcare system in the region. He sees patients in Philadelphia, PA, and also in Langhorne, PA. His work as an anesthesiologist involves helping people manage their pain levels before, during, and after various surgical procedures, which is, you know, a critical part of any operation. He's also a pain medicine physician, working with individuals who experience ongoing discomfort.

What Does an Anesthesiologist Do?

An anesthesiologist, like Jeffrey Truitt MD, plays a truly vital role in surgery. Their main job is to keep you comfortable and safe during an operation. This starts even before you enter the operating room, where they talk with you about your health and the best way to manage any discomfort. They might, for instance, discuss different types of anesthesia that could work for you.

During the procedure, the anesthesiologist is constantly watching your body's responses. They monitor your heart rate, breathing, and other important signs to make sure everything is going as it should. It's a bit like being the person who keeps all the systems running smoothly while the surgeon does their work. This ongoing observation is, you know, really important for patient well-being.

After the surgery is done, their work isn't over. Anesthesiologists also help manage any pain you might feel as you recover. They might suggest different ways to ease discomfort, which can really help with the healing process. So, they're involved at every step, making sure your experience is as good as it can be.

Expertise in Pain Medicine

Beyond his work in surgery, Jeffrey Truitt MD is also a pain medicine physician. This field is about helping people who experience ongoing or severe discomfort that isn't always linked to a surgical procedure. It could be back pain, nerve pain, or other kinds of persistent aches that really affect daily life. A pain medicine doctor, like him, tries to figure out the source of the discomfort and then create a plan to help lessen it.

These days, there are many different approaches to managing discomfort. Some involve medications, while others might include special procedures or even lifestyle changes. A pain medicine physician will often work with other medical professionals to give you a full range of care. It's, you know, a very personalized kind of care, because everyone's experience with discomfort is different.
